Ibhetri ye-lithium polymer

Ibhetri ye-lithium yepolymer luhlobo lwebhetri etshajwayo kwifom encinci. Ezi bhetri zilungele izixhobo eziphathwayo ezifuna ngaphezulu kwe-3 watts kodwa ngaphantsi kwe-7 watts, ezifana neelaptops kunye neeselfowuni. Iibhetri ze-lithium zepolymer zathiywa umxube we-lithium ion kunye neepolymers (into eneemolekyuli ezinkulu) ezenza ulwakhiwo lwazo.

Iibhetri ze-lithium ze-polymer zihluke kwiibhetri ze-lithium ion kuba azinayo isahluli phakathi kwee-electrodes ezilungileyo kunye nezibi. Iipolymers ezisetyenziswa ngaphakathi kwezi bhetri zinokufana okufanayo nejeli, yiyo loo nto zibizwa ngokuba ziiseli zejeli. Iibhetri ze-lithium ze-polymer nazo zinenzuzo yokungabi namathuba okufumana ukuvuza kwe-electrolyte xa kuthelekiswa nezinye iintlobo zeebhetri ze-lithium ion kuba akukho sahluli sikhoyo.

Iipolymers zizinto eziziimolekyuli ezinkulu, ezinokuxhathisa ukushisa okuphezulu kunye nokubola okuthile.

Iipolymers ezisetyenziswe ngaphakathi kweebhetri ze-lithium polymer zibonelela ngezinto eziphuhlisa i-gel-efana ne-gel xa kuthelekiswa nezinye iintlobo zeebhetri ze-lithium ion. I-electrolyte yenziwe nge-solvent ye-organic enokuveliswa ngaphandle kwe-lithium, ngoko iba yinto ebiza kakhulu ibhetri.

Iibhetri ze-lithium ze-polymer zisetyenziswa kwizicelo ezininzi kuba ziguquguquka kwaye zikwazi ukunyamezela amaqondo aphezulu aphezulu kunezinye iintlobo zeebhetri ze-lithium ion. Banobunzima obungaphantsi kunabo bangaphambili, obuvumela umsebenzisi ukuba abambe isixhobo esiphathwayo ixesha elide ngaphandle kokuva ubunzima okanye iintlungu ezihlahleni nasezandleni zabo.
